The whole rear guard was placed under the command of the noble, generous, handsome and brave General Gist, of South Carolina.

I loved General Gist, and when I mention his name tears gather in my eyes.

I think he was the handsomest man I ever knew.
Our army was a long time crossing the railroad bridge across Chickamauga river.

Maney's brigade, of Cheatham's division, and General L.E.Polk's brigade, of Cleburne's division, formed a sort of line of battle, and had to wait until the stragglers had all passed.

I remember looking at them, and as they passed I could read the character of every soldier.
